Types of Natural Body Oils and Their Properties

Natural Body Oils and Their Properties

There are several types of natural body oils, each with unique properties beneficial to different skin types. Here are some popular ones:

  • Coconut Oil: Known for its moisturizing and antibacterial properties, coconut oil is ideal for dry and sensitive skin. It provides intense hydration and can help relieve minor skin irritations.
  • Jojoba Oil: This oil mimics the skin’s natural sebum, making it effective for balancing oil production. It’s suitable for all skin types, especially oily and acne-prone skin.
  • Almond Oil: Rich in vitamin E, almond oil nourishes and softens the skin. It’s great for combating dryness and improving complexion.
  • Argan Oil: Often called “liquid gold,” argan oil is packed with antioxidants and essential fatty acids. It’s ideal for hydrating and revitalizing dull or mature skin.
  • Rosehip Oil: Known for its anti-aging benefits, rosehip oil is high in vitamins A and C. It helps reduce scars, fine lines, and pigmentation issues.

Incorporating Body Oils Into Your Daily Routine

Body oils can be a luxurious addition to your daily skincare routine, promoting hydration and glowing skin. Here’s a guide on how to seamlessly integrate them:

  1. Application Methods:
    1. After Shower: Apply body oil when your skin is still damp. This helps lock in moisture.
    1. Dry Skin: Use it whenever your skin feels dry to provide immediate hydration.
  2. Best Usage Times:
    1. Morning: Helps in protecting and moisturizing the skin throughout the day.
    1. Night: Acts as a nourishing treatment so your skin can repair as you sleep.
  3. Layering With Other Products:
    1. Before Lotion: Apply body oil first, followed by a lotion to seal in the moisture.
    1. As a Base: Use it before applying sunscreen or makeup for a smooth base.
  4. Practical Tips:
    1. Warm the oil in your hands for better absorption.
    1. Use a few drops and massage gently into the skin to avoid a greasy finish.
    1. Experiment with different oils to find which suits your skin type best.

Potential Drawbacks and Considerations

While organic body oils offer many benefits for your skin, it’s important to be aware of potential downsides. Here’s what you should consider:

  • Allergic Reactions: Some individuals may experience allergies to certain natural body oils. It’s essential to patch-test new oils on a small area of skin before full application.
  • Greasy Texture: Natural body oils can sometimes feel greasy, especially if over-applied. To avoid this, use a small amount and gradually increase as needed.
  • Sensitive Skin: Those with sensitive skin should choose non-comedogenic oils to prevent clogged pores and breakouts.
  • Ingredient Check: Always examine the ingredients for potential allergens.
